Things appear smaller next to the new spacious KIA Venga
In 2010 KIA Motors launched a new hatchback car called Kia Venga in Poland. The launch campaign – devised by Polish independent agency Paralotna – introduced a tagline: Things appear smaller when you have more space. The key benefit which the campaign tried to convey was that Venga is a spacious car with attractive design.
The TV ad employed a special shooting technique called “Tilt & Shift” which makes real objects appear as small-scale mock-ups. The miniature models are juxtaposed with the spacious interior of the new Kia Venga to support the message of the campaign. The song used in the TV spot – “Like The Rainbow” by Bruno Pilloix & Alyse Pilloix – has become pretty popular thanks to the campaign.
This year KIA continues the Kia Venga campaign under the same slogan but with a new TV ad which also communicates the unique Kia’s 7-year warranty. The new song featured in the TV copy is Nadia Fay’s Come Home To Me.
